[1] 16 teams took part, fourteen of them returning from last season plus Boyacá Chicó and Fortaleza, who were relegated from the 2016 Primera A.

The former played in the second tier after 13 years while the latter returned after one season in the top flight.

Both teams replaced América de Cali and Tigres who earned promotion at the end of the last season.
